I am using GoogleTranslate() function to translate one language to another in Google spreadsheets.
I have a sentence in one (known) language at column A1 ‘Lorem ipsum dolor sit amet’ and i want the translation of it in English at column B1.
so i used this:
=GoogleTranslate(A1, "li", "en")
The result is:
"Lorem ipsum dolor sit amet".
There is double quotes now.
I want the translation to be with single quote (like before),
I found its Google’s bug (yes, i said it Google’s bug lol).
So the solution maybe in within regular expression or something else…
How can I replace the double quotes (in the being and the end only) of the translated sentence in Google spreadsheets?
